Journaling serves as a powerful tool for self-discovery, offering individuals a structured yet flexible way to explore their thoughts, feelings, and experiences. One of the primary benefits of journaling is that it provides a safe space for self-expression. In this private domain, individuals can articulate their innermost thoughts without fear of judgment or criticism.

This freedom encourages honesty and vulnerability, which are essential for genuine self-exploration. By putting pen to paper, one can confront emotions that may have been suppressed or overlooked, leading to a deeper understanding of oneself. Moreover, journaling fosters clarity and organization of thoughts.

Techniques for Getting going with Journaling for Self-Discovery





Starting a journaling practice can feel daunting for many, but there are several strategies that can ease the transition into this reflective habit. First and foremost, it is essential to create a comfortable environment conducive to writing. This could mean finding a quiet space free from distractions or setting aside specific times each day dedicated solely to journaling.

Establishing a routine can help reinforce the habit and make it feel like an integral part of one's day. Another helpful tip is to approach journaling without rigid expectations. It is important to remember that there is no right or wrong way to journal; the process should be organic and personal.

Individuals may choose to write freely about their thoughts or follow specific prompts—what matters most is that the writing feels authentic.
